WebMay 26, 2006 · When you want multiple object sharp, than you either need to align then on the focal plane, or you need to shoot with a bigger DoF. Typically, a portait requires about f/2.8 to get the facial features sharp, while still giving a pleasing blur towards the background. A portrait of two people often requires f/4, to get both faces sharp.
